Vitiligo on Hands: Constant Exposure and Friction
The hands are one of the most common places to get it and also one of the hardest to treat. They are always being hit with water, soaps, chemicals, and friction from machines.
Challenges specific to hand vitiligo include:
-
A lot of washing and drying
-
Exposure to chemicals at work
-
Less time to rest and heal the skin
-
More likely to happen is the Koebner phenomenon
These factors slow repigmentation and make maintenance harder, basically.
Vitiligo on Feet: Reduced Circulation and Healing Pace
Vitiligo on the feet and ankles responds more slowly due to less blood flow.
Factors contributing are included.
-
Not enough blood flow
-
Pressure from shoes all the time
-
Skin that is dry and thick
-
Not as much natural sunlight
This does not mean things cannot improve; you must keep caring for them.

Managing Expectations for Different Areas
The patch's location affects the response time. Hands and feet usually take longer to heal than patches on the face.
Success should be measured not only by repigmentation but also by:
-
Not making any new patches
-
Stability of areas already there
-
More emotional comfort and confidence
These results show that real progress has been made.
